Ingredients You’ll Need

List of Main Ingredients

To make this delightful casserole, here’s what I typically gather:

  • 2 chicken fillets
  • 3 medium-sized potatoes
  • 1 onion
  • 2 eggs
  • 200 ml (about 7 oz) of cream
  • 150 grams (about 5.3 oz) of Emmental cheese
  • 1 tomato
  • Olive oil, salt, black pepper, and chicken seasoning

Preparation Steps

Prepping the Chicken Fillet

I start by cleaning the chicken fillets and trimming off any unwanted fat. Then, I like to cut them into bite-sized pieces for even cooking. Adding a sprinkle of salt, pepper, and chicken seasoning helps enhance their natural flavor, and I let them marinate for a little while to absorb those wonderful spices.

Preparing the Potatoes

Next, I peel the potatoes (sometimes I leave the skin on for added texture) and slice them thinly. This way, they cook evenly and beautifully absorb the creaminess of the other ingredients. I usually soak them in water for a few minutes to prevent browning while I prepare the onion and other veggies.

Chopping Additional Ingredients

With the potatoes ready, I chop the onion and tomato finely. The onion adds sweetness and depth, while the tomato brings a touch of acidity to balance the richness of the dish. At this stage, I also crack the eggs into a bowl and whisk them lightly to blend before combining with the cream later on.

Cooking Instructions

Assembling the Casserole

Now comes the fun part! I preheat my oven to 200°C (390°F) while I layer the ingredients in my baking dish. First, I spread half of the potato slices evenly at the bottom. Then, I top them with a layer of the marinated chicken pieces, followed by a sprinkling of the chopped onion and tomato. After that, I add the remaining potatoes on top.

Cooking Time and Temperature

To bring all the flavors together, I whisk together the cream and eggs in a bowl and pour this mixture over the assembled casserole. Finally, I cover the dish with aluminum foil and pop it into the oven, letting it cook for about 50 minutes. After this time, I remove the foil, sprinkle the grated Emmental cheese on top, and let it b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, allowing the cheese to brown.

Tips for Perfect Baking

While the casserole is baking, I love to check in on it through the oven door, just to see that golden cheese bubbling away. I recommend ensuring the potatoes are tender by piercing them with a fork. If they slide right through, it’s time to dig in!

Storage and Reheating

How to Properly Store Leftovers

If there happen to be leftovers (which is rare, but it happens!), I always let the casserole cool completely before storing it in an airtight container. It’s best to refrigerate it within two hours to maintain freshness.

Best Practices for Reheating

When I’m ready to enjoy the leftovers, I preheat my oven to about 180°C (350°F) and transfer the casserole into an oven-safe dish. I cover it with foil to keep it moist, and let it heat for about 20-30 minutes, or until it’s warmed through.

Freezing Options and Tips

For times when I want to prepare ahead, I’ve had success freezing this casserole. I’ll assemble everything (but the cheese), cover it tightly with plastic wrap and aluminum foil, and stash it in the freezer. When I’m ready to enjoy it, I thaw it overnight in the fridge and bake as usual!

Frequently Asked Questions

Common Cooking Problems and Solutions

Some folks worry about their casseroles being dry. I always assure them that the cream and eggs help keep the dish moist. A tip is to cover it while baking until the last few minutes, as I mentioned. If overcooking is a concern, keeping an eye on it during the last bit of baking is key!

Can I Substitute Ingredients?

Absolutely! This recipe is quite flexible. If I’m out of cream, I’ve used Greek yogurt as a healthier alternative. Chicken breast can be swapped for thighs, and the potatoes can be replaced with sweet potatoes for a different twist on flavor and nutrients.

How to Scale the Recipe for Larger Groups

Scaling up is surprisingly easy. I just multiply the ingredients, using a larger baking dish. It’s important to keep an eye on cooking time since larger casseroles may take a bit longer to bake through evenly.
